Aluminum floating dock sections and ramps built from scratch. Shown here are 3 sections of our 6' x 12' configuration with a sturdy trussed ramp. Other configurations are available. These docks are built to last with all aluminum construction, pressure tested rectangular pontoons and stainless steel hardware and hinged brackets. Refurbishing some bronze impellers. After the trouble spots are built up with weld, the leading edges are roughed out on the milling machine followed by the draft angle for the outside diameter on the lathe. The piece is secured in a custom arbour to ensure concentricity in both operations. They'll be finished and polished by hand.
Machining the 5 degree draft angle on a marine impeller. Slow-mo of course. We are refurbishing these phosphorous bronze impellers by building them up with weld at the worn sections and then machining the critical features again. More pics to follow!
Made a "quick change" pallet to hold the 6" chuck on our 5axis #dmg_mori using the table centre bore and a stud, it will locate accurately ever time we put the chuck on the table. We use the chuck often so it's a real time saver on set ups. #instamachinist
